WebMay 6, 2024 · My research revealed the safety of bin cages is highly debated among hamster owners, breeders, and vets. One side states that hamsters chew through bin cages and escape or become sick when chewing on the plastic. WebWhy is my hamster chewing on his skin and scratching himself? Thank you for using PetCoach! There are many reasons for itching and overgrooming including bacterial infections, mite infestations and trauma. Your vet can take some skin samples to determine the exact cause. This part of the hamsters anatomy, the forward and projecting part of the … tamarind ashevilleWebA lethargic hamster is often a sign of an unhappy hamster. If all they’re doing is sleeping, eating, drinking, and sleeping again this is a sign that they are depressed. Unless they’re old, it is not a good sign to see a hamster stuck in a loop of repetitive behaviors.
